The Hotel Nacional Inn Iguacu is situated in Foz do Iguaçu, a vibrant city in southern Brazil renowned for its spectacular natural attractions. The hotel is ideally positioned near the iconic Iguazu Falls, allowing guests easy access to breathtaking views and lush surrounding national parks. Additional attractions such as the Bird Park and the Itaipu Dam are conveniently close, offering diverse experiences for nature lovers and tourists.
The accommodations at Hotel Nacional Inn Iguacu range from cozy standard rooms to luxurious suites, each designed to provide ample comfort and modern conveniences. Rooms are furnished with plush bedding, free Wi-Fi, and flat-screen TVs, ensuring a relaxing stay for every guest.
The hotel`s dining options are varied, encompassing an on-site restaurant that serves a delicious selection of local and international cuisine. Guests can start their day with a hearty breakfast and enjoy meals prepared with fresh, regional ingredients.
For those looking to unwind, the hotel features comprehensive wellness amenities including a swimming pool, a fully equipped gym, and a tranquil spa. These facilities provide guests with the opportunity to relax and recharge after a day of exploration or work.
With a well-designed business center and multiple meeting rooms, the hotel is also equipped to host corporate events and conferences, making it an excellent choice for business travelers. The sophisticated environment and attentive service ensure a productive experience.
Whether traveling with family, as a couple, or for business, the Hotel Nacional Inn Iguacu offers a blend of convenience and comfort in a picturesque setting, appealing to a wide range of guests.